WitrynaExploring the history of speech and language therapy gives us the opportunity to understand where we have come from and recognise how this influences our current … Witryna13 sie 2014 · The Case History identifies any red flags that may be a factor or a contributing factor to Speech and Language difficulties. The Case history may take 15 minutes to 30 minutes before the Speech Therapist starts to testing the child.

(2) It is important to address the client's process of realisation by navigating around … quick file downloaderWitrynaA case history including medical and family history. A general observation of the patient’s speech, language and interaction skills. A more detailed assessment of the patient’s speech, language and communication abilities.
